Python数据库高级应用(三):SQLAlchemy框架实现Oracle数据库驾驭 深入挖掘Python高级技术,本文聚焦于利用SQLAlchemy框架驾驭Oracle数据库。首要任务是确保Oracle Instant Client已经成功安装完毕。紧接着,借助以下指令,一键安装SQLAlchemy和cx_Oracle库:pip install SQLAlchemy,pip ins
Springboot PDFBox PDFRenderer类应用与问题优化 Springboot项目中的PDF文档处理变得更加智能化,得益于PDFBox库中强大的PDFRenderer类。本文将全面解析如何在Springboot环境下使用PDFRenderer类,将PDF文档转化为图像,并深入讨论在开发和使用过程中可能遭遇的PDF转换问题及其解决方案。PDFBox的PDFR
Spring Boot与Canal Adapter实现数据库实时监听与数据自定义消费 这个项目探讨了如何使用Spring Boot集成Canal-Adapter,以实现对数据库数据的实时监听和自定义消费。Canal是基于MySQL数据库增量日志解析的工具,旨在提供增量数据的订阅和消费功能。作为阿里巴巴的开源CDC工具,Canal能够获取MySQL的binlog数据并进行解析,然后将数
Canal1.1.5版本服务端客户端源码详解 Canal1.1.5版本是一个性能优越的开源项目,主要用于解决访问GitHub下载速度过慢的问题。该版本在MQ发送的性能上进行了重点优化,单个topic的最高峰值可支持3~8万的rps,实现了数量级上的性能提升。此外,新版本还新增了一些重要特性,包括对不同topic设置不同分区数的支持、rabbit